> Apart from different settings (which I have not checked), Debian has
> the very useful option "[-F device] [--file=device]" which allows you
> to do stty to a file or device which would block on an ordinary open,
> i.e. on a "stty < device". The -F makes stty do an O_NONBLOCK open on
> the specified file.
> What is the situation for other dists?
